Series 5 (Idea, not real!)


Right, so we know Takeshi is still popular and we'd all love to see new episodes. AND, we all know that there are some games that were cut out of Challenge episodes.

Well, we could have loads of episodes full of Slipped Disks, Final Fall, with added Karaoke and Quake... But obviously no one would watch that. SO, they could easily make a new mini series, because there is still demand. That way there aren't many episodes so it wouldn't be as expensive as a full series, but everyone would be happy because there are new episodes!

I've worked out that 7 episodes are easily possible. Ep 1 is a special looking back, re-uniting Tani and Takeshi. Eps 2 - 5 are "Unseen" specials. These are in the same style as the Best Ofs, ending with the Flashback and no Show Down. Eps 6 and 7 are the 100 Best Moments ever.


Series 5

Episode 1:
(The Peace Agreement ep)
Craig narrates a story, like in the specials. Something like: The last we saw of the General, he had died. However, due to thunder striking his stick he was miraculously brought back to life. But, he decided not to waste anymore of his newly re-gained life on failing to storm Takeshi's Castle (all this has flashback clips from the last special).
After all these years, Takeshi and the General have decided to meet up, and to put the past behind them.

Something like that anyway, then this Peace Agreement show contains the highlights from:
